Paul Carter

Paul Warren Carter (Nick)

Position: Pitcher
Bats: Left, Throws: Right
Height: 6' 3", Weight: 175 lb.

Born: May 1, 1894 in Lake Park, GA
School: Rhodes College (Memphis, TN) (All Transactions)
Debut: September 15, 1914
Teams (by GP): Cubs/Indians/Naps 1914-1920

Final Game: September 20, 1920
Died: September 11, 1984 in Lake Park, GA
Buried: Lake Park Cemetery, Lake Park, GA
